Colleges and universities located in the city include the University of Memphis (previously Memphis State University), Rhodes College (previously Southwestern at Memphis), Le Moyne-Owen College, Crichton College, and Christian Brothers University. The city is served by Memphis City Schools while surrounding suburbs in other areas of Shelby County are served by Shelby County Schools. The Memphis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A), the 42nd largest in the US, has a 2003 populus of 1,239,337, and includes the Tennessee counties of Shelby, Tipton, and Fayette, as well as the Mississippi counties of DeSoto, Marshall, Tate, and Tunica, and the Arkansas county of Crittenden. As of the census of 2000, there were 650,100 people, 250,721 households, and 158,455 families residing in the city. The populus density was 2,327.4 people per sq mi (898.6/km²). There were 271,552 housing units at an avg density of 972.2 per sq mi (375.4/km²). The racial makeup of the city was 61.41% African US, 34.41% White, 1.46% Asian, 0.19% Native US, 0.04% Pacific Islander, 1.45% from other races, and 1.04%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 2.97% of the populus.
